What Does a Chemist Do- A Comprehensive Guide

A chemist is a scientist who studies the composition, structure, and properties of matter, and the changes it undergoes. 

They work in fields like analytical, organic, inorganic, physical, and biochemistry, and use their knowledge to develop products, processes, and treatments that solve everyday problems.

Common tasks of a chemist include conducting experiments, analyzing data, and developing new or improved products and processes. 

In addition, chemists often collaborate with other scientists and engineers to ensure that products meet safety and quality standards. 

What Skills Do Chemists Need?

Chemists need a broad knowledge of mathematics, physics, and chemistry, as well as laboratory skills and the ability to think critically and solve problems. They must also be able to communicate effectively with colleagues and clients, and be able to work independently or as part of a team.
